Maple Pecan Granola

Oats, nuts and seeds baked slowly in maple and oil until golden, then left completely undisturbed to cool so it sets into clusters. The clusters are the entire craft.

Method

  1. Heat the oven to 150°C / 300°F and line a large baking tray with paper.

  2. Combine the oats, nuts, seeds, coconut, cinnamon and salt in a large bowl.

  3. Warm the maple syrup, oil and brown sugar together until the sugar dissolves, then stir in the vanilla.

  4. Pour over the dry ingredients and mix thoroughly until every oat is coated.

  5. Fold in the lightly beaten egg white, which will help the clusters bind.

  6. Tip onto the tray and press it down firmly into an even, compacted layer about 1.5 cm thick.

  7. Bake 25 minutes, then rotate the tray and bake 20 minutes more, without stirring, until evenly golden.

  8. Take it out and leave it on the tray, completely undisturbed, until stone cold — at least 90 minutes.

  9. Only now break it into clusters with your hands, and fold through the dried fruit.

Chef’s Tips

  • Do not stir during baking or cooling. That is the entire secret to clusters.
  • Press the mixture down hard before it goes in. Compaction is what lets it set as a slab.
  • Add dried fruit only after baking — it burns and turns bitter in the oven.

Storage & Reheating

Keeps 3 weeks in an airtight jar at room temperature and freezes 3 months.
